Difference between revisions of "Pgo"
Jump to navigation
Jump to search
Line 14: | Line 14: | ||
pgo create pgadmin -n pgo hostcmd | pgo create pgadmin -n pgo hostcmd | ||
+ | ``` | ||
+ | |||
+ | |||
+ | |||
+ | https://access.crunchydata.com/documentation/postgres-operator/latest/quickstart/ | ||
+ | |||
+ | https://access.crunchydata.com/documentation/postgres-operator/latest/ | ||
+ | |||
+ | https://access.crunchydata.com/documentation/postgres-operator/4.6.2/architecture/high-availability/ | ||
+ | |||
+ | https://www.crunchydata.com/developers/download-postgres/containers/postgres-operator | ||
+ | |||
+ | Expose api | ||
+ | |||
+ | microk8s.kubectl port-forward -n pgo svc/postgres-operator 8443:8443 | ||
+ | ``` | ||
+ | |||
+ | Run some commands | ||
+ | ``` | ||
+ | pgo create cluster hippo | ||
+ | pgo show cluster -n pgo --all | ||
+ | pgo show user hippo --show-system-accounts | ||
+ | ``` | ||
+ | |||
+ | ``` | ||
+ | pgo create cluster hacluster --replica-count=2 --pod-anti-affinity=preferred --pgbouncer | ||
``` | ``` |
Revision as of 00:09, 28 June 2021
- https://access.crunchydata.com/documentation/postgres-operator/latest/architecture/high-availability/
- https://access.crunchydata.com/documentation/postgres-operator/4.1.1/operatorcli/cli/pgo_create_user/
- https://access.crunchydata.com/documentation/postgres-operator/4.6.2/tutorial/tls/
Install client
https://github.com/jeremybusk/k8s-zabbix-deploy/blob/main/pgo/install-pgo.sh
kubectl -n pgo port-forward svc/postgres-operator 8443:8443 pgo create cluster hostcmd --service-type=NodePort --replica-count=2 --pod-anti-affinity=required psql -h kub1 -U testuser -p 317xx -d postgres pgo create pgadmin -n pgo hostcmd
https://access.crunchydata.com/documentation/postgres-operator/latest/quickstart/
https://access.crunchydata.com/documentation/postgres-operator/latest/
https://access.crunchydata.com/documentation/postgres-operator/4.6.2/architecture/high-availability/
https://www.crunchydata.com/developers/download-postgres/containers/postgres-operator
Expose api
microk8s.kubectl port-forward -n pgo svc/postgres-operator 8443:8443
<br />Run some commands
pgo create cluster hippo pgo show cluster -n pgo --all pgo show user hippo --show-system-accounts
<br />
pgo create cluster hacluster --replica-count=2 --pod-anti-affinity=preferred --pgbouncer ```